That’s something else I never used to do – visit Craigslist.

So, I was just looking around, and found an ad for some old Kaleidoscope newspapers. Kaleidoscope was our underground paper in the late 60s in Milwaukee, and I kinda-sorta remember them… ok, so I’m pretty familiar with them – hey, I was 15 in ’69, happy now?

Anyway, so I called the guy, he told me what he was asking, and I said, “ok, thanks.” After I came down from the clouds, I thought, “what the hell am I going to do with ’em? Just for a trip down memory lane?” I just get so caught up in that stuff sometimes, ya know? Although I did call him back and told him if he couldn’t sell them to call me back.
